I think that the aims of the game of science are something like the following:

1. If the scientist is to play the game of science, the scientist must attempt to solve problems. 'Problems' are, in part, situations where expectations and observation-reports clash, but on a more general level, situations where a body of knowledge is incoherent. The scientist, then, wants his expectations and observation-reports to agree with one another in all cases.

2. To solve this dispute between expectation (scientific theory) and observation-reports, one must determine whether the theory of the observation-report is false, then revise either of the two. In other words, the scientists must weed out false theories so as to correct their mistakes, in some cases correcting their lower-order theories about observations.

3. It would be very easy for the scientist to weed out all sorts of trivial false theories, such as "all of the spoons on this here table are dirty," yet these theories are so limited in scope as to be uninteresting to the scientist. Thus, trivial theories are not as interesting to the scientist as more general, more predictive theories.

4. Whenever a theory has been eliminated, a new theory must be chosen to take its place. This new theory must explain all the past successes of the superseded theory, and also make novel predictions about future events. It is best to choose a theory that is as interesting as possible, for uninteresting theories are not suitable replacements for superseded theories. Some of the most interesting theories are strictly universal statements ("all x are y").

If our minds are the product of evolution, then we have little reason to trust their epistemic reliability. Evolution doesn’t care about what’s true, it only cares about what will further our survival and reproduction.

Charles Darwin himself expressed this concern:
>But then with me the horrid doubt always arises whether the convictions of man’s mind, which has been developed from the mind of the lower animals, are of any value or at all trustworthy. Would any one trust in the convictions of a monkey’s mind, if there are any convictions in such a mind?

Evolution and metaphysical naturalism, coupled together, appear to be self-defeating.

You wake up in the morning and find yourself back to back in bed with an unconscious violinist. A famous unconscious violinist. He has been found to have a fatal kidney ailment, and the Society of Music Lovers has canvassed all the available medical records and found that you alone have the right blood type to help. They have therefore kidnapped you, and last night the violinist’s circulatory system was plugged into yours, so that your kidneys can be used to extract poisons from his blood as well as your own. [If he is unplugged from you now, he will die; but] in nine months he will have recovered from his ailment, and can safely be unplugged from you.
